The Future Is Unknown, So Plan Accordingly

The future is unpredictable. Rather than betting on forecasts, diversification helps investors prepare for a range of outcomes. Plan, don’t predict.

I saw a great Forbes article recently that reinforced the fragility of forecasting using a quarter-century-old anecdote about the Pentagon changing the way they identify future threats. The change stemmed from a review of how quickly the geopolitical landscape evolves—yesterday’s adversaries can become tomorrow’s allies. Rather than focusing on one specific forecast, it was more prudent to be prepared for all possible outcomes.

This echoes what we often say at Dimensional: Plan, don’t predict. We all have views about what the future may bring: companies that will succeed, economies that will grow, markets that will take off. Markets set prices based in part on the aggregate of these expectations. So, market prices already represent a forecast of the future. However, some investors may let their personal forecasts drive their asset allocation decisions. Dogmatic adherence to forecasts dictates concentrated investments that fall short in the event the future differs from our predictions. Diversifying portfolios is a tacit admission that we don’t have a crystal ball. You reduce the range of outcomes by preparing for what you can’t see coming.

Country stock market returns are a good example of this. Going all-in on one country because you have a view on where their stocks are headed opens you up to a wide range of outcomes. The average difference between the best- and worst-performing developed market countries over the past two decades was over 50 percentage points. Get your call right, and you’ll look like a hero. Get it wrong, and you’ll be as apoplectic as when Chevy Chase’s character loses the rock paper scissors game in Vegas Vacation.
